Transaction c601342cba59d88bad699e06583aa60e280d7107cda25ba9cd02bd9834ed0185
1 Input
1 Output
-
c601342cba59d88bad699e06583aa60e280d7107cda25ba9cd02bd9834ed0185:0
- value
- 66487065999
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 716456ba1e521d90532b3d343650880245cc8c3b OP_EQUALVERIFY OP_CHECKSIG
- address
- DFUf6bWNc28tV54qHoyoXjUdVaYu2Rp2Rw